
在TP钱包里看到“扫描签名”,很多人第一反应是:它是不是直接把链上数据抓下来就完事了?其实不然。要把签名识别得准、把风险排得干净,就需要一套从链下计算到安全补丁、再到实时资产分析与智能化数据管理的完整流程。下面用教程思路带你把这件事拆开看清楚,你会更容易判断自己看到的结果是否可信。
第一步,先理解“链下计算”在做什么。签名往往和交易、合约调用、消息结构相关,但真正的可读性通常要靠链下解析:把原始交易输入拆字段、还原签名消息的上下文、再计算出你要的摘要或校验项。对用户而言,核心不是“算得多复杂”,而是“算得对”。你要留意TP钱包在解析时是否能稳定复原关键字段,比如目标合约地址、调用方法选择器、参数编码形式,以及签名消息的来源。
第二步,配套“安全补丁”。扫描签名不是纯技术秀操作,真正危险的是恶意合约或畸形数据触发解析漏洞。安全补丁通常体现在几个方面:对异常长度或非法编码进行拦截;对疑似重放场景设置校验;对跨链/跨版本差异做兼容白名单;以及对风险合约模式进行标记。实战建议你在发起扫描前先确认钱包版本是否为最新,并留意是否有提示“安全更新已启用”。这一步决定你看到的结果是“可用”还是“可能被带偏”。
第三步,把“实时资产分析”接上。签名扫描结束后,很多人只盯结果字符串,却忽略了资产层面的含义。你应该把扫描到的签名结果映射到具体操作:是转账、授权(approve/permit)、路由交易、还是合约铸造与赎回。随后对影响范围做快速估算,例如该操作是否会触发代币额度变化、是否引入新代币合约风险、是否涉及授权额度上升。只要资产变化与你的直觉不一致,就要回到前面重新检查签名解析是否命中正确的交易字段。

第四步,理解“智能化数据管理”。钱包并不只是“扫描一次就结束”。它通常会对合约返回值、解析中间产物、风险标记进行结构化缓存。你可以观察:相同合约的历史调用是否能更快、更一致地被复用;异常返回是否被记录并二次验证;同一笔交易是否在不同网络环境下保持一致解释。好的数据管理让你能追溯,避免“看见一次就信了”的盲区。
第五步,看懂“合约返回值”。合约不总是给你想要的文本,更多时候返回的是编码后的数据。专业做法是结合返回值类型与调用上下文进行判读:成功与否是否能从返回数据或事件里对上;失败是否体现为自定义错误或回退原因;关键数值是否因单位不同而误读。你在复核时要检查返回值是否与转账或状态变化一致,避免把“看起来像成功”的返回当成真实结果。
第六步,做“专业解读分析”。当签名扫描完成后,你应当把信息落到可行动的判断上:是否存在无限授权风险;是否存在可疑委托合约;是否有与同类交易不一致的参数模式;以及是否触发了已知高风险操作路径。最后一步才是确认:如果你只是验证“这笔签名是不是我发起的”,就对比来源账户、nonce/时间窗与交易哈希关联;如果你是在排查风险,就用资产变化与返回值证据闭环。
评论
PixelFox
终于有人把链下计算和合约返回值讲清楚了,读完我知道该怎么复核而不是只看字符串。
小雨夜猫
安全补丁那段很关键!以前我只更新钱包版本,没想到还要留意异常编码拦截。
ChainLynx
教程风格很实用,尤其是把扫描结果映射到授权/资产变化这点。
阿尔法鲸
智能化数据管理的“可追溯”让我想起历史记录复用,确实能减少误判。
NovaLily
合约返回值的判读讲得比较到位,成功/失败怎么对上别被表象带跑。
风行Q
专业解读分析部分让我知道该怎么给出最终判断,感谢整理。